Ambigara Chowdayya Vachana Collection Complete Vachanas of Nijasaran Ambigara Chowdayya Nijasaran Ambigar Choudaiya lived in 12th century Shivasaran and Vachankara. He was born in 1160 AD in Ranebennur taluk of Haveri district in Chaudadanapura. Ambigar Choudaiahs original name was Chaudesha. His mothers name is Pampadevi and fathers name is Virupaksha. He has a different and unique personality from all the other speakers. Ambiga by profession, intuitive by instinct. He was busy ferrying people from one bank to the other in his boat on the banks of the Tungabha river in Chaudadanpur during the reign of the Guttalar kings. It is seen that the vachanas were written with direct fearless words. Ambigar Choudaiya was a 12th century follower of Basavanna. Along with Guru Basavanna, Ambigara Choudaiya, along with Guru Basavanna, destroyed all the superstitions about religion and Gods that existed in the masses for thousands of years and brought the pro-idea arguments and realistic aspects to the attention of the people. Ambigar Choudaiya is the one who spoke boldly, but walked as he spoke, and spoke as he walked. In reality a rebel, a revolutionary surrender, a humble man. He is Kayaka Yogi like all Sarans. Boating is his kayak. About 278 verses of his have been found. He used Vachanankita in his name. Ambigar Choudaiahs impactful verses reflect deep experience and social consciousness. Ambigar Choudaiya is a monotheist, a worshiper of Ishtalinga, an opponent of temple shrines, everyone should do Ishtalinga Puja. There is no difference here.
